Team Lead (Production)

Essential Job Functions

  • Demonstrates SoundOff Signal’s Core Values in daily interactions with internal and external customers

Team Building:

  • Demonstrated abilities of active listening, effective speaking, future thinking and the mentoring towards our one team approach.
  • Management of Personnel Resources through motivating, developing, and directing people as they work, and identifying the best people for the job.
  • Able to recognize every team members contributions and encourages them to work together as a team.
  • Develop a team environment by aligning talents and providing the members with the tools to be successful.

Planning:

  • Assess daily department requirements, capacity, and capability.
  • Schedule daily work assignments.

Organizing:

  • Coordinate fulfillment of customer requirements with excellence and accuracy, including management of order changes and exceptions.
  • The ability to multi-task effectively as needed.

Communication:

  • Able to communicate well (written, verbal)
  • Able to strategically delegate tasks to team members as needed.
  • Able to read, follow and train team members to follow SoundOff Signal Work Instructions.
  • The ability to work as a linking pin between production team members and the management team.

Leadership:

  • Able to coach and lead employees by example to meet department goals.
  • Able to quickly but calmly handle urgent situations with due diligence and reasonable care.
  • Mechanical aptitude including troubleshooting ability with department equipment.
  • Balancing hands on involvement with background support functions to maximize department throughput capacity.
  • Disciplinary activities within department when required.
  • Able to keep the team focused and motivate the team towards its goal.

Measure:

  • Problem Sensitivity and Solving. Being able to tell when something is wrong, or about to go wrong, then use critical thinking and deductive reasoning to identify problems, gather and analyze data, construct, evaluate, and implement solutions.
  • Able to report department progress, completion, non-completion of work and the reasons for each.
  • Able to measure the performance of employees to understand where their need is to grow, learn and comply with SoundOff Signal Standards.

Quality:

  • Ensures the products manufactured meet our SoundOff Signal quality standards.
  • Able to check finished product as needed to ensure quality standards are being met and keep records of equipment, deliveries and worker performance.
  • Assuring quality control procedures (ISO, ESD) are being followed.

Safety:

  • Place the safety of team members in high esteem, educate them in SoundOff Signal safety procedures and ensure procedures are adhered to.
  • Assuring team members are aware of all needed PPE (Personal Protective Equipment) and are following all PPE requirements.
  • Able to evaluate manufacturing equipment for safety and functionality.

  • Ability to work minimum 8 hour shifts, and flex hours early or late with little or no notice.
  • Ability to hold the department and team members to our SoundOff Signal 5S standards.
  • Able to perform job consistently and without excessive absenteeism or tardiness.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Job Requirements

  • High School Diploma required. Equivalent combination of education and experience may be considered.
  • Competent in all processes within the department.
  • Willing and able to train others in all department processes
  • Two (2) to four (4) years electronics experience.
  • One (1) year supervisory experience.

Physical Requirements

  • Able to lift up to 35 lbs.
  • Able to stand, sit, walk, bend, twist, rotate, and/or reach throughout an entire shift.
  • Must be able to accurately handle and assemble small parts.

Working Conditions

  • Light manufacturing environment
  • Fast-paced, team-oriented environment
  • Low noise level in a temperature-controlled setting
  • Required to work shift hours (four 10-hour days) with occasional overtime

Schedule

  • Monday-Thursday, 3:00pm-1:00pm; overtime on Fridays as needed
